The investigation into the disappearance of Nancy Guthrie continues to grip national attention as law enforcement agencies pursue new leads in what authorities believe is a kidnapping case.
Nancy Guthrie, the 84-year-old mother of Savannah Guthrie, vanished from her home near Tucson, Arizona, in early February 2026. Investigators say evidence at the scene strongly suggests she was taken against her will.
Now, after months of speculation and online rumors, officials have made a major clarification: members of the Guthrie family are not considered suspects.
Sheriff Publicly Clears the Family
Pima County Sheriff Chris Nanos recently addressed widespread rumors surrounding the case and stated that the Guthrie family has been fully cooperative throughout the investigation.
Authorities specifically pushed back against online speculation targeting individuals close to Nancy Guthrie, including those who were among the last known people to see her before her disappearance.
According to investigators, family members are being treated as victims, not perpetrators.
The sheriff’s comments came after weeks of intense public scrutiny fueled by social media theories and internet speculation surrounding the high-profile case.
What Investigators Know So Far
Law enforcement believes Nancy Guthrie disappeared sometime during the night after being dropped off at her home on January 31, 2026. Officials say she had limited mobility and relied on medication, making voluntary disappearance highly unlikely.
Investigators have identified several pieces of evidence they consider critical:
- Doorbell camera footage showing a masked individual near the property
- Blood evidence found at the home
- A glove recovered near the scene
- DNA and hair evidence currently under forensic analysis
Retired FBI profiler Jim Clemente told media outlets that blood evidence suggested Nancy Guthrie was alive when she was removed from the home.
Authorities have not publicly identified a formal suspect.
FBI Expands Involvement
The Federal Bureau of Investigation has become deeply involved in the investigation alongside the Pima County Sheriff’s Department.
Federal investigators are reportedly analyzing forensic evidence, surveillance footage, and potential DNA matches tied to the scene. Officials have also conducted searches connected to leads developed during the investigation.
The reward for information has grown significantly:
- The FBI is offering $100,000
- The Guthrie family has reportedly increased the total reward to more than $1 million
Authorities hope the financial incentive will encourage witnesses or individuals with knowledge of the case to come forward.
Savannah Guthrie Speaks Publicly
Savannah Guthrie has largely remained private throughout the ordeal but has occasionally spoken publicly about the emotional toll the disappearance has taken on her family.
In a Mother’s Day message posted online, she shared an emotional plea expressing hope that her mother would be found.
She has also criticized false online accusations aimed at her relatives, describing the speculation as deeply painful during an already devastating situation.
